Assoc Prof Yeo us an experienced respiratory and sleep physician with broad clinical expertise particularly in advanced non‑invasive respiratory support and complex sleep disordered breathing.
As the Medical Director of the Lung Function Laboratory and Clinical Lead of the Respiratory Failure and Sleep Medicine Service at the Royal Adelaide Hospital, he has a longstanding interest in respiratory physiology, with a particular focus on physiological measurement, interpretation and education.
As a Clinical Title Holder at the Adelaide University, Assoc Prof Yeo is a passionate and engaging educator who is committed to developing the next generation of healthcare professionals. He regularly delivers teaching to medical students, junior doctors, specialist trainees, nurses, allied health professionals and respiratory/sleep scientists on topics including non-invasive ventilation, arterial blood gas interpretation and cardiopulmonary exercise testing.
Special Interests
- Non-invasive ventilation
- Obstructive sleep apnoea
- Obesity hypoventilation syndrome
